Pankaj Batra Biography

Pankaj Batra is a Punjabi film director, with many hit films in his credit. Director of popular cinema, he has worked with some of the leading artists of Punjabi cinema and music. His popular movies include – Sajjan Singh Rangroot, Bambukat, Channa Mereya, Goreyan Nu Daffa, Naughty Jatts, and Dildariyaan which gave him commercial success. He has worked with Punjabi actors - Diljit Dosanjh, Ammy Virk, Amrinder Gill etc. He launched TV actress Payal Rajput through Channa Mereya in 2017. Now she is a popular actress of Punjabi and south Indian films. The movie was Punjabi remake of Marathi blockbuster, Sairat, released one year earlier.

 

Pankaj Batra hails from   Chandigarh. As a film director, his first full-fledged movie was Reejhan (2005). The movie starring Ranjeet, Aryan Vaid, and Bunti Garewal went unnoticed. Since then he has stayed in Punjabi cinema for nearly 15 years, associated with many commercial hits. Before he established as a film director in Punjabi cinema, he tried with directing TV serials too. In 2007 he directed Chaldi Da Naam Gaddi for ZEE Punjabi followed by a show titled Hum Tum in 2008.

 

Same year he directed an indo-Pakistan movie, Virsa starring Arya Babbar, Mehreen Raheel, Noman Ijaz, Gulshan Grover and Kanwaljit Singh. This big budget film included very popular romantic song, "Main Tenu Samjhawan", which was reused for Humpty Sharma Ki Dulhania starring Alia Bhat and Varun Dhawan, and was a huge chartbuster. As a full-fledged Indian film director, Naughty Jatts (2013) was his first film, followed by a bunch of hits. In 2016 his movie, Bambukat earned him Filmfare awards for best film director in Punjabi. The movie also bagged Best Sound Design award at Filmfare awards.
